Farrell’s Top 10 Most Important 2024 Quarterback Commits

Mike Farrell on why DJ Lagway, Jadyn Davis, Mabrey Mettauer, and others are crucial to their recruiting classes

Mike Farrell| September 26, 2023 (Updated: July 9, 2025)
FacebookTweetPin
2024 five-star QB DJ Lagway from Willis
2024 five-star QB DJ Lagway from Willis

2024 recruiting is flying towards the early signing period. Here are the most important QB commitments so far, in my humble opinion.


1. DJ Lagway to Florida

— Lagway was a must-get for Billy Napier after the Jaden Rashada debacle, and he has a bright future. When Austin Simmons reclassified and decommitted, Lagway became even more important and is massive for Napier.

2024 Five-Star QB DJ Lagway from Willis, TX (Willis) – Committed to Florida

2. Jadyn Davis to Michigan

— Jim Harbaugh needed to close this one out as the North Carolina star was a heavy lean forever but didn’t pull the trigger for what seemed like the longest time. Davis following JJ McCarthy changes the perception of Harbaugh as a QB recruiter.

2024 five-star quarterback Jadyn Davis from Charlotte, NC (Providence Day School) — Committed to Michigan

3. Julian Sayin to Alabama

— He wasn’t on my earlier lists, but with the Alabama QB issues, he’s looking more and more like a massive get for Nick Saban.

2024 five-star quarterback Julian Sayin from Carlsbad, CA (Carlsbad) – Committed to Alabama

4. Walker White to Auburn

— Hugh Freeze needed a big QB recruit in his first full year, and White has a chance to be crucial in this rebuild. He’s honestly the future of the program at the position as the cupboard is bare.

2024 four-star quarterback Walker White from Little Rock, AR (Little Rock Christian) – Committed to Auburn

5. Elijah Brown to Stanford

— Troy Taylor needed to make a splash in recruiting as things have become stagnant, and Brown is a massive get. He will bring much-needed skill position talent with him.

2024 four-star quarterback Elijah Brown from Santa Ana, CA (Mater Dei) – Committed to Stanford

6. CJ Carr to Notre Dame

— ND quarterback recruiting hasn’t been elite in recent years, so landing Carr, a Michigan legacy with a high ranking, was huge. You could argue he’s the most anticipated signal caller to head to ND since Jimmy Clausen.

2024 four-star quarterback CJ Carr from Saline, MI (Saline) – Committed to Notre Dame

7. Mabrey Mettauer to Wisconsin

— A new head coach, a new OC, and a new offense need an elite QB, and Mettauer has a huge ceiling. The Trevor Lawrence vibes go beyond the great hair.

The Woodlands quarterback Mabrey Mettauer runs for a touchdown during the first half of a Region II-6A Division I area high school football playoff game against Klein Cain, Friday, Nov. 18, 2022, in The Woodlands.

8. Cutter Boley to Kentucky

— Mark Stoops needs to keep elite kids home, especially a QB the caliber of Boley. It would have been a disaster to lose him.

Cutter Boley selected the University of Kentucky as the school he will play football. May 18, 2023

9. Dylan Raiola to Georgia

— UGA recruiting is off the charts, so landing a 5-star QB isn’t a huge deal, but this was still a massive recruiting win.

Chandler quarterback Dylan Raiola throws the ball against Corona del Sol during their game at Chandler High School on Friday, Sept. 9, 2022.

10. Air Noland to Ohio State

— After Dylan Raiola decommitted, the Buckeyes needed to land an elite QB after taking a shot on Lincoln Kienholz a year ago. Noland fits the bill.

2024 four-star quarterback Air Noland from Fairburn, GA (Langston Hughes) – Committed to Ohio State
